Donorbox – Free Recurring Donation Form

Description

Donorbox, a unique WordPress Donation Plugin, helps your organisation quickly embed an optimised recurring donation form in your website. Our form builder allows you to collect custom questions from your donor, ask your donor where to designate her donation, and dedicate her donation in honour of someone.

There are many other features of our WordPress Donation Plugin that your organisation may find useful including customizable receipt text, PayPal donation, Salesforce & MailChimp integration, and much more. Donorbox is available in Español, Français, Deutsch, Italiano, Português and last but not least English. ACH donations and Corporate matching integration are in the works.

Donorbox is FREE for your first $1,000 donation EVERY month. Stripe merchant account charges 2.9% + $0.30 for credit card processing. Fees can be discounted for registered nonprofits. Email sales+nonprofit@stripe.com

It takes no more than 10 mintues to start fundraising. Signup at Donorbox.org This plugin will embed Donorbox Donation Form to your site using shortcode ‘[donate]’ and ‘[donate-with-info]’. The settings is very simple. One input box for either the full Donorbox url e.g. https://donorbox.org/campaign-id or the part after the ‘/’ ‘campaign_id’. No embed code needed. We will generate the embed code for you!

Dashboard > Settings > Donorbox

Please check our “Getting Started” guide for more details: https://donorbox.org/nonprofit-blog/wordpress-donation-plugin/

How to prefill fields in WordPress Donorbox form?

Donorbox allows to prefill some fields in the donation form including amount. You can append field values as query parameters to the donation url used with the shortcode. Pre-filling of following fields are supported:

amount
first_name
last_name
email
phone
address
zip_code
recurring

Example:
[donate https://donorbox.org/rebel-idealist?first_name=Fname&last_name=Lname&email=user@example.com&phone=1234567890&amount=30&address=Newstreet&zip_code=54321&recurring=true]

or

[donate-with-info https://donorbox.org/rebel-idealist?first_name=Fname&last_name=Lname&email=user@example.com&phone=1234567890&amount=30&address=Newstreet&zip_code=54321&recurring=true]

Screenshots

  • Settings page
  • Website Screen
  • Website Mobile
  • Select Amount
  • Donor Info
  • Payment Info

Installation

  1. Unzip the zipped file and upload to the /wp-content/plugins/ directory
  2. Activate the plugin through the ‘Plugins’ menu in WordPress
  3. Manage individual options from Dashboard > Settings > Donorbox
  4. After signing up on Donorbox.org, create a donation campaign from the dashboard.
  5. Paste in the Campaign url: [input box]
  6. Use the shortcode [donate] to embed the donation form. You can also use the shortcode [donate-with-info] which will include the campaign description and legal disclaimer that was on Donorbox.
  7. You can also set the URL from shortcode using [donate url=”https://donorbox.org/campaign-id”] or [donate-with-info url=”https://donorbox.org/campaign-id”]. This allows to set multiple forms for different campaigns.
  8. Please check our “Getting Started” guide for more details: https://donorbox.org/nonprofit-blog/wordpress-donation-plugin/

FAQ

Installation Instructions
  1. Unzip the zipped file and upload to the /wp-content/plugins/ directory
  2. Activate the plugin through the ‘Plugins’ menu in WordPress
  3. Manage individual options from Dashboard > Settings > Donorbox
  4. After signing up on Donorbox.org, create a donation campaign from the dashboard.
  5. Paste in the Campaign url: [input box]
  6. Use the shortcode [donate] to embed the donation form. You can also use the shortcode [donate-with-info] which will include the campaign description and legal disclaimer that was on Donorbox.
  7. You can also set the URL from shortcode using [donate url=”https://donorbox.org/campaign-id”] or [donate-with-info url=”https://donorbox.org/campaign-id”]. This allows to set multiple forms for different campaigns.
  8. Please check our “Getting Started” guide for more details: https://donorbox.org/nonprofit-blog/wordpress-donation-plugin/
What is the shortcode I need to use?

Use the following shortcode in your posts / pages or the template file: [donate] or [donate-with-info]
The plugin will replace the shortcode with embed frame using the settings provided in admin.

Where is the settings page?

Dashboard > Settings > Donorbox

Contributors & Developers

“Donorbox – Free Recurring Donation Form” is open source software. The following people have contributed to this plugin.

Contributors

Changelog

7.0

  • Google Pay for Donorbox

6.2

  • Fix width issues on mobile devices when the description is enabled [donate-with-info].

6.1

  • Support PHP strict standards.

6.0

  • Multiple forms support for different campaigns.
  • Pass campaign URL from shortcode.

5.0

  • Widget height is dynamically calculated, therefore height input field has been removed.

4.0

  • Embed code updated.
  • Description updated.

3.0

  • Updated the embed code to have min and max widths.

2.0

  • Widget height customization option added.

1.2

  • Tags updated.
  • Short description updated.

1.1

  • Instructions layout update.
  • Settings page screenshot udpate.

1.0

  • Initial Commit.